Types of Filters for Rainwater Systems
Not all filters are the same. Here’s a breakdown of common rainwater filter types you’ll come across:
➤ First-Flush Filters
These ensure the first dirty flow of rainwater from your roof doesn’t enter your tank. This type of rainwater filter accessory is perfect for keeping the water clean from the start.
➤ Mesh or Screen Filters
These are basic filters that block larger debris like leaves and twigs. They’re good for basic setups but require regular cleaning if not self-cleaning.
➤ In-Ground Filters
Installed below ground, these work best for larger properties. They're built to handle significant volumes and are usually hidden from sight.

Don’t Forget the Accessories
Filters aren’t the only thing to consider. To complete your system, you’ll also need rainwater filter accessories.
-
Diverter Kits – Direct water efficiently to your storage tank.
-
Leaf Guards – Stop large debris before it even enters the filter.
-
First Flush Diverters – Discard the first dirty rainwater flow.
-
Sediment Traps – Catch finer particles before they enter the tank.

Maintenance Tips for Rainwater Filters
Even the best water filter for rainwater needs some care. Here’s how you can keep it working well for years:
-
Regular Checks: Inspect the filter during and after each rainy season.
-
Clear Debris: Remove leaves or twigs caught in any surrounding area.
-
Monitor Flow Rate: If water isn’t flowing well, it might be time for a quick clean.
-
Use Self-Cleaning Filters: These significantly reduce how often you need to do anything at all.
